Transaction 06b7570f2abcf788b89a841ee461e019fc4cc8f59e87419efadd23aba29e3a8e
1 Input
2 Outputs
- 06b7570f2abcf788b89a841ee461e019fc4cc8f59e87419efadd23aba29e3a8e:0
- 06b7570f2abcf788b89a841ee461e019fc4cc8f59e87419efadd23aba29e3a8e:1
value 625849
address 3QnaRt8pFq67bwrEtBZ5rLjEJqGfoweTja
value 1699786
address 18VkqVxNxdFZ1jRsMJuWdwXer4DtCtV4KC